Output 8f55dc3a284a5f1d60ccd63bef4bd1ffd0c498d24d4d1d597b11c47171e3e88e:9

value
21287486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1252eaab571d15bf1ee1e4cfec4cca050887dce1 OP_EQUAL
address
M9a3j2yVDKkcvXBkdkF7Y9rreBXW6WZ2GU
transaction
8f55dc3a284a5f1d60ccd63bef4bd1ffd0c498d24d4d1d597b11c47171e3e88e
spent
true